Common Bathroom Fan Repair Jobs
Bathroom fan repair involves fixing or replacing malfunctioning ventilation fans to improve air circulation.
Fan motor replacement restores proper operation when the motor has burned out or stopped working.
Switch and wiring repairs address electrical issues that prevent the fan from turning on or off correctly.
Ventilation system troubleshooting identifies and resolves noise, vibration, or inadequate airflow problems.
Exhaust fan cleaning and maintenance ensures optimal performance and reduces the risk of mold and odors.
Control and timer repairs restore proper fan operation for energy efficiency and convenience.
Bathroom Fan Repair Questions
Why is my bathroom fan not turning on? It could be due to a faulty switch, a blown fuse, or an electrical issue that needs inspection.
How do I know if my bathroom fan needs repair? Signs include persistent noise, inadequate airflow, or the fan not operating at all during use.
Can a bathroom fan be repaired or should it be replaced? Many issues can be fixed through repairs, but severe damage or age may require a replacement for optimal performance.
What common problems affect bathroom fans? Common problems include motor failure, clogged vents, and wiring issues that impact proper operation.
